Chris Bosh claims Texas as his state of residency in child support case against Allison Mathis

While Chris Bosh and his wife Adrienne vacation in Europe, his lawyers are hard at work on the pending case between Bosh and his ex-girlfriend/baby’s mama, Allison Mathis. Bosh recently filed court papers in an Orlando court maintaining his state of residence as Texas not Florida where he and his wife own a 12,000 sq. foot mansion worth $12 million.

Instead, Bosh is claiming a home in Dallas as his main residence. This home is around 1,900 sq. feet and worth about $73,000. What’s the benefit in that you ask? Bosh currently pays Mathis $2600 a month in child support, a shift in residency would make Mathis eligible for 3% of his monthly take home pay, around $30,000 a month.
